There’s one major flaw with anime that oddly enough is not addressed. Basically 90%+ anime are based off manga that’s printed in weekly or monthly magazines. The problem here is almost all anime end oddly (or a cliffhanger) or there are odd fillers in the main story. The manga is also a spoiler for the anime, people who read the manga usually spoils it for the anime watching public as well. So you are forced to read the manga to avoid spoilers and to catch up on the story, when you do that the anime sucks and doesn’t mean as much.
